About your new opportunity
As Housing Coordinator, you will oversee housing allocations, tenancy services, and property maintenance while promoting tenant participation and well-being. Your leadership will ensure quality housing support for those at risk of homelessness or in need of stable, affordable housing.
You will be working with a passionate, dedicated, and supportive team of housing workers in a busy office environment. No two days are the same, and the team works diligently to achieve the best outcomes for all our tenants.
Key aspects of the role include
- Lead a team of Housing Officers, ensuring excellent service delivery.
- Oversee tenancy management, property maintenance, and tenant engagement.
- Monitor housing programs to align with client needs and organisational goals.
- Ensure compliance with tenancy laws and organisational policies.
- Promote feedback mechanisms and tenant participation activities.
- Prepare reports on tenancy trends, program outcomes, and property standards.
What you’ll bring to our team
- Diploma in social housing, community services, or equivalent experience.
- Minimum five years’ proven experience in service coordination or housing programs.
- Knowledge and understanding the housing needs and issues of people on low incomes, homeless or at risk at homelessness.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to engage with diverse stakeholders.
- Problem-solving and decision-making skills to manage challenges effectively.
- Commitment to safety, quality standards, and continuous improvement.
- Possess a current National Police Certificate, Working with Children (Blue Card) – or the ability to obtain.
- Current driver’s licence.
Who we are – Churches of Christ
Churches of Christ is one of Australia’s largest and most diverse not-for-profit organisations, delivering a range of care and community services across Residential Aged Care, Home Care and Retirement Living, Foster and Kinship Care and, Housing Support for over 140 years.
We are guided by our values of Integrity, Compassion, Excellence and Courage, and we welcome everyone, of all backgrounds and faiths, as we foster a diverse and inclusive community for our people.
